    I voted Yes.

    Sorry for the D & M, but I'm hepped up on panadeine forte ATM and my emotions are swinging more frequently than Capmaster when he gets dolly back from BJ_M ....

    Call me a geek with no life (wide open here, lads), but I consider a lot of people here as "virtual" friends, and I feel that there is a real community spirit going on. Especially with the addition of skpye, where it's been possible to chat with those who you're so used to reading posts and PMs from. You can get a real sense of who everyone is, even though they're still "hiding behind the keyboard/microphone" so to speak. I don't know whether it used to happen before my time here, but I sense that we have progressed a lot deeper into each others' lives, tot he point where there is genuine concern for our fellow OTPW and their family members.

    Maybe it indicates an absence of this cameraderie in "real" life, I don't know. Either that or it's an escape from reality....

    Well said Jimm

    I think that rather than friendships in OT being a substitute for real friendships, I think they are rather real friendships that reflect the way technology can put people in touch even across the world, allowing us to create friendships at a great distance.

    After all, just 10 years ago the internet was just beginning to become popular. Before that, the only options would have been long-distance telephone and snail-mail. THe web gives us the ability to "hang out" together every day, share life experiences, and even talk real-time. Same as if we were kicking back at the corner pub 8)
